Question is not clear...well had u asked which topics u
need to prepare to get a job ?...then
1. Testing definition, objective, techniques,methods
2. Types of testing
3. SDLC Models
4. STLC
5. Bug/defect life cycle
6. Documents - SRS, Testcase, Test Log, Tracebility matrix,
Test Summary Report, Test Plan
7. GUI
10.Web Testing
11. Few metrices
12. A bit of SQL
These are the contents for a person hunting with 1+ yrs of
exp
